About Us

Impilo yeAfrica is a leading provider of mental health care and research services, dedicated to improving the mental well-being of individuals, families, employees, and communities across South Africa and the African continent. The burden of mental health conditions, particularly depression, continues to rise globally, with over 264 million people affected. Mental health problems are often neglected in Africa, despite the availability of effective psychological and pharmacological interventions. Our mission is to reduce the impact of mental illness and improve the quality of life for those affected.

Our team of experienced psychologists is committed to delivering exceptional care through individual psychotherapy, family therapy, and community-based mental health programmes. We also conduct important research on mental health issues, contributing to a deeper understanding of mental illness and its societal impact.

We aim to facilitate transformation by providing compassionate and evidence-based care, while also raising awareness of mental health issues and promoting access to mental health services across the continent.


Services Provided

Impilo yeAfrica offers a comprehensive range of mental health care services that address a variety of psychological needs. These services include:

Individual Psychotherapy

We provide one-on-one psychotherapy for individuals experiencing:

  • Depression and Anxiety Disorders: Addressing the symptoms and root causes of depression and anxiety.
  • Trauma and Stress-Related Disorders: Offering support to those affected by past traumatic experiences or ongoing stress.
  • Family Issues: Helping families navigate conflicts, communication issues, and relationship challenges.
  • Self-Reflection and Transformation: Facilitating personal growth, self-awareness, and transformation through therapy.

Research Services

Our research focuses on understanding and addressing the mental health challenges facing individuals and communities. We are involved in the following key areas of research:

  • Prevalence of Mental Health Problems: Assessing the widespread impact of mental health disorders in different populations.
  • Burden of Mental Health in Chronic Illness: Exploring the additional psychological burdens experienced by those living with chronic medical conditions.
  • Understanding Mental Health and Illness: Investigating the societal and individual impacts of mental health issues.

Employee Wellness

We understand the importance of mental well-being in the workplace and offer the following services to improve employee health and productivity:

  • Telepsychotherapy: Providing remote therapy options for employees in need of support.
  • Psychological Tools: Offering resources to help employees manage stress, improve mental health, and cope with challenges.
  • Individual Psychotherapy for Employees: Providing tailored therapy to employees to address personal or work-related mental health concerns.
  • Wellbeing Policies for Employers: Drafting and implementing policies to promote employee mental health and create a supportive work environment.

Community Mental Health Care

We are committed to expanding mental health care into communities, ensuring that individuals have access to support, education, and early detection of mental health issues. Our community services include:

  • Psychotherapy and Counselling: Providing psychological support to individuals in community settings.
  • Education and Awareness Programmes: Raising awareness of mental health and reducing stigma in communities.
  • Supervision for Healthcare Workers: Offering guidance and support to healthcare professionals working with mental health patients.
  • Training on Mental Health and Illness: Educating healthcare providers and community members on mental health issues and effective treatment strategies.
  • Early Detection and Screening: Helping identify mental health concerns early to ensure timely intervention.
  • Integration into Primary Care: Working to incorporate mental health services into primary healthcare settings for broader accessibility.

Meet Our Psychologists

Dr. Zimbini Ogle – Clinical Psychologist

Dr. Zimbini Ogle is a registered clinical psychologist with the Health Professions Council of South Africa (PS 0117730) and the Board of Health Care Funders (PR 086 001 0755974). She earned her MA in Clinical Psychology from Nelson Mandela University and her PhD in Psychiatry from Stellenbosch University.

Dr. Ogle’s training includes psychodynamic psychotherapy, c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T), narrative therapy, solution-focused brief therapy, and transactional analysis. She brings a wealth of knowledge and expertise to her work, with a focus on helping clients navigate complex emotional and psychological challenges.
